iframe安全盲区:支付信息窃取攻击的新温床
💡
原文中文,约2100字,阅读约需5分钟。
📝
内容提要
攻击者利用恶意覆盖层技术绕过安全策略,通过支付iframe窃取信用卡数据。近期针对Stripe的攻击已影响数十家商户,攻击者注入恶意JavaScript脚本,隐藏合法iframe并替换为假冒表单。现有防御措施不足,需要加强CSP策略和实时监控以应对新型攻击。
🎯
关键要点
- 攻击者利用恶意覆盖层技术绕过安全策略,窃取信用卡数据。
- 近期针对Stripe的攻击已影响数十家商户,攻击者注入恶意JavaScript脚本。
- 支付iframe本应隔离信用卡数据,但攻击者通过入侵宿主页面实现绕过。
- 攻击已入侵49家商户,使用废弃的Stripe API实时验证被盗卡片。
- 18%的网站在支付iframe内运行Google Tag Manager,形成安全盲区。
- 现代框架引入iframe新漏洞,包括供应链攻击和DOM注入。
- CVE报告激增30%,涉及iframe利用的XSS攻击占Web应用攻击总量的30%以上。
- 传统X-Frame-Options标头难以应对新型攻击。
- 攻击者可利用postMessage漏洞和同源策略漏洞实现绕过。
- 提出六层深度防御方案,包括强化CSP策略和实时iframe监控。
- PCI DSS 4.0.1新规要求商户确保支付iframe宿主环境安全。
- iframe安全性取决于宿主页面,攻击焦点已转向周边盲区。
- 企业需立即实施防御策略,避免成为数据泄露的统计数字。
❓
延伸问答
攻击者是如何通过支付iframe窃取信用卡数据的?
攻击者利用恶意覆盖层技术,注入恶意JavaScript脚本,隐藏合法的支付iframe并替换为假冒表单,从而窃取信用卡数据。
近期针对Stripe的攻击影响了多少商户?
近期针对Stripe的攻击已影响49家商户。
现有的防御措施存在哪些不足?
传统的X-Frame-Options标头难以应对新型攻击,CSP frame-src限制和同源策略漏洞也被攻击者利用。
如何加强支付iframe的安全性?
可以通过强化CSP策略、实时iframe监控、安全PostMessage处理等六层深度防御方案来加强安全性。
CVE报告中与iframe利用相关的攻击占比是多少?
涉及iframe利用的XSS攻击占Web应用攻击总量的30%以上。
企业应如何应对iframe安全盲区?
企业应立即实施六项防御策略,以避免成为数据泄露的统计数字。
➡️